📰 Here are the top five stories in Los Angeles today:

1) Route fire update: As of Saturday, the Castaic Route fire is 71% contained. Firefighters were able to keep it at its 5,208-acre size. Officials anticipate full containment by Wednesday. However, two structures were destroyed. (Whittier Daily News/paywall)

2) There was a commercial building fire at 770 East 17th Street on Friday afternoon. “The 2,254-square-foot building, which was built in 1999, had electrical wires down near its front, but 70 firefighters were able to extinguish the flames.” If you noticed some smoke over the 10, that’s where it came from. (KTLA, LAFD)

3) The L.A. City Council voted Friday to approve $129,000 “to remove graffiti and provide other maintenance efforts on the Sixth Street Bridge.” The sum is a marked decrease from the originally requested $353,000. To put this in perspective, “crews spent an average of 14 1/2 hours combined each day in August removing graffiti from the bridge.” (NBC)

4) Trusaic, a software company, will move from Koreatown to the DTLA Biltmore Court. It “is relocating its corporate headquarters to a reimagined workspace at 520 S. Grand Ave.” (Biz Journals)

5) Do you need a COVID-19 or monkeypox vaccine? Today from 4 p.m. to 8 p.m., the Health Department is offering vaccinations at the Levitt Pavilion in MacArthur Park. You see their setup behind the bandshell when you enter on 6th and Parkview. (LA Public Health)
